Description
ADS1110A1IDBVTG4 Overview
Texas Instruments is a well-known brand in the electronics industry, known for producing high-quality and reliable components. One of their latest offerings is a Data Acquisition - Analog to Digital Converters (ADC) chip, designed for precision data conversion. This chip falls under the Data Acquisition - Analog to Digital Converters (ADC) category and boasts impressive features such as a PGA and Selectable Address. It is also surface mountable and has a wide operating temperature range of -40°C to 125°C. With a peak reflow temperature of 260°C, this chip is built to withstand harsh environments. It has 6 pins and operates on a single 5V supply, with a digital supply voltage range of 2.7V to 5.5V. The ADC chip has a sampling rate of 128 sps and can handle both differential and single-ended inputs.
